General Summary
Implementing , Executing and delivering of the various activities in the billet handling area aimed at ensuring smooth production and delivering quality product to the customer
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Executes Billet Handler duties assigned by the supervisor according to production requirements. • To ensure availability of consumables and tools required for carrying out billet handling operation in the CC machine as supervised • Ensures that all Billet Handling safeties in the machine are working and abides by the company policy to confirm to safety regulations. • Ensure separation between heats in sequence and take samples whenever it is necessary. • Ensure stacking out of specification heats separately from good billets and identify them. • Ensures that Casting work area is clean and free of any obstacles or encumbrances to avoid accidents or hazards
Essential Duties and Responsibilities(Contd)
Ensures the effective implementation of Billet Handling operational policies covering all areas of the casting plant so that all relevant procedural / legislative requirements are fulfilled while delivering a cost –effective quality product to Casting operation. • Carries out Billet Handling timely check on the billet quality to ensure consistent product quality • Carries out billet dispatch activity timely as per plant requirements & rolling mill requirements. • Maintain production data in computer, SAP & department register. • Ensure appropriate action is taken to overcome emergency situation in the billet handling area by manual gas cutting or manually operating the discharge device as need arises as instructed. • Housekeeping, mille scale cleaning & 5S maintain in working area.
Additional Duties and Responsibilities
- To impart training for new employees • To coordinate with cranes and the casting operator regarding the quality of billets supplied by the CC plant.

Key Performance Indicators
- To ensure that all relevant safety, health, environmental management policies & procedures are abided to guarantee employee safety • To ensure shift production targets are achieved to meet the annual production plan of the section & department • To ensure that the billets supplied to the RM or export order through material handling are of acceptable quality
